Long Distance Swimming Event by Swim Maldives
Over 37 participants swam from Kurumba Maldives resort to capital Male on Saturday — covering 5.2 kilometres — as part of an island-to-island long distance swimming event hosted by Swim Maldives. Follow the coverage from our sister publication The Edition: https://edition.mv/sports/8294

Gertrude Ederle’s swim suit
In 1926, Olympic gold medalist Gertrude Ederle became the first woman to swim across the English Channel – and when she did she became, for a brief time, the most famous woman int he world. She is remembered to day a s a pioneer in the gender equity movement.

Solo swimmer Martin Hobbs takes on Lake Malawi
Solo Swimmer Martin is preparing himself mentally, physically and emotionally, to take on a never done before swim from North to South on Lake Malawi, for the challenge, adventure and in aid of Smile Foundation.

‘The Swim’ Ended With 1,000 New Scientific Samples… Here’s What’s Next | The Swim
Broken sails don’t mean broken spirits for Ben Lecomte and his team. After six grueling months on the water, ‘Seeker’ has landed in Hawaii with a treasure trove of rare data and a commitment to a cleaner future.
